Spain Renews Gender Violence Pact Amid Rising Denial Among Youth

In Spain, 1,294 women have been murdered due to gender violence since 2003; studies show a rise in young men denying its existence, prompting the government to renew its State Pact with 400 new measures despite facing political obstacles.

Federal Prison Camp Closures Highlight Need for Community-Based Alternatives

The Bureau of Prisons is closing seven federal prison camps due to high costs and security issues related to rampant contraband, specifically cell phones; expanding community-based alternatives like halfway houses and home confinement is proposed as a more effective and cost-efficient solution.

Meta Cuts 3,600 Jobs Amidst AI Hiring Push

Meta is cutting approximately 3,600 jobs (5% of its workforce) globally today, primarily through performance-based terminations, while simultaneously expanding its AI engineering teams, reflecting an industry-wide shift towards specialized talent acquisition.

Italian Activist Sues Over Paragon Spyware Hacking

Luca Casarini, an activist with Mediterranea, filed a lawsuit in Palermo against unknown individuals for hacking his phone with Paragon's Graphite spyware, which can record and capture data; the suit aims to identify those responsible and any state connections.
